'93 Civic CX wiring to '95 B16A DelSol?
OK, I've done this before and didn't have any problems. . . . the swap went fine. I used a '94 Teg LS engine wiring harness so I didn't have to wire in the four wire O2 and wired in the Vtec switch, Vtec oil press. land Knock senser. By the way, the car has a '93n EX cluster in it(I didn't put it in). Well, the problem I'm having is that with everything hooked up the "CHECK ENGINE LIGHT" comes on. So, I reset the ECU and start it again, comes back on. So, I check for codes, the connector under the dash on the pass. side. Well, the c/e/l stays on. So, I do step one again, comes back on. recheck all wiring and make sure that all is connected(they are). Reset, c/e/l, Try to check code, it just stays on. . . . does anyone know what that can be? I even tried to put another ECU in it and it does the same thing. I can't check codes. The light just stays on. It doesn't blink at all. . . HELP please. . . . .

Re: '93 Civic CX wiring to '95 B16A DelSol? (eg6_LHD)
To check c/e/l codes you turn off the key and right above the ECU is what I call the code checker port. The plug with two wires going to it. You stick a jumper in it and turn the key to the on position. Then you whatch the c/e/l to see how many times it blinks. Well, it doesn't blink! And the ECU I'm using is out of a '94 DOHC DelSol 5spd.
